The Ultimate Guide To Spend Management Software

In today’s fast-paced business world, it’s more important than ever for companies to effectively manage their spend in order to stay competitive and profitable. One of the best ways to achieve this is through the use of spend management software.

spend management software is a tool that helps organizations track, analyze, and control their spending across various categories such as procurement, expenses, and budgeting. It provides businesses with real-time visibility into their financial data, helping them make informed decisions and optimize their financial processes.

There are many benefits to using spend management software. One of the key advantages is the ability to centralize all spending data in one platform, allowing for easier tracking and analysis. This can help companies identify areas of overspending or potential cost savings opportunities, leading to more effective budgeting and forecasting.

Another major benefit of spend management software is improved compliance and risk management. By automating spend processes and enforcing policy controls, businesses can ensure that all spending is in line with company policies and regulations. This reduces the risk of fraud and errors, ultimately leading to better financial health for the organization.

Additionally, spend management software can help businesses streamline their procurement processes, leading to faster and more efficient purchasing. By automating tasks such as vendor selection, purchase order approvals, and invoice processing, companies can reduce the time and effort spent on these activities, allowing employees to focus on more strategic tasks.

Furthermore, spend management software can provide valuable insights into supplier performance and pricing trends. By analyzing historical spending data, businesses can negotiate better contracts with suppliers and identify opportunities for cost savings. This can help companies build stronger relationships with their vendors and improve their overall supply chain processes.

When choosing a spend management software solution, there are a few key features to consider. Firstly, the software should offer comprehensive reporting and analytics capabilities, allowing businesses to gain insights into their spending patterns and identify areas for improvement. It should also be user-friendly and intuitive, making it easy for employees to use and adopt.

Integration with other financial systems is another important feature to look for in spend management software. The ability to connect with accounting, ERP, and procurement systems can help streamline data flows and ensure accurate information across all platforms. This can help reduce errors and improve overall efficiency in spend management processes.

In terms of implementation, businesses should take the time to properly train employees on how to use the spend management software effectively. This can help ensure a smooth transition and maximize the benefits of the software. Additionally, regular updates and maintenance are essential to keep the software running smoothly and up to date with the latest features and security measures.
